LG Innotek (KRX: 011070) announced that it has successfully developed a high-performance hybrid lens for autonomous driving with a small size and thickness, at a price that is more competitive than other products on the market.

Cameras are an important component of autonomous driving solutions as they help detect driver movements.

The company has developed new lenses for driver monitoring systems (DMS) and advanced driver assistance (ADAS).

They are characterized by the fact that the company bonds the inside of the lens with plastic and glass.

In contrast, other glasses use only glass to prevent structural deformation due to temperature changes or external factors.

The company is the first company to use plastic material for high resolution (8Mp) ADAS lenses.

The company was able to reduce the size and cost of the lens by using plastic.

As cameras are increasingly used inside vehicles, the company says the new lens offers automakers more flexibility in vehicle design.

“High power lenses are 20 to 30 percent thinner than all glass products. The thinner they are, the greater the freedom of interior and exterior design,” said a company representative. “The higher the level of self-monitoring, the more devices are used for detection. Therefore, it is important to reduce the size of parts.

The company claims that its new lens has been able to bring the performance of its new lens to the level of all-glass lenses thanks to technology that ensures stable performance regardless of temperature.

LG Innotek hopes to jump-start the in-cabin camera lens market.

Camera lenses used in autonomous vehicles are built into camera modules

These are important components of autonomous driving for driver assistance and driver recognition. All vehicles in Europe must be equipped with DMS from 2025.

According to Strategy Analytics, the global market for autonomous driving cameras is expected to grow by about 17 percent annually, from 4.2 trillion won in 2021 to 7.9 trillion won (US$6 billion) in 2025.
